Pancreatic pseudocyst: comparative evaluation by sonography and computed tomography.

M E Williford, W L Foster, R A Halvorsen

    AJR. American Journal of Roentgenology
    |January 1, 1983
    PubMed
    Summary

    Computed tomography (CT) is more accurate than sonography for diagnosing pancreatic pseudocysts and assessing their extent. CT identified more pseudocysts and had fewer inadequate or false-positive results compared to sonography.

    Area of Science:

    • Gastroenterology
    • Radiology
    • Medical Imaging

    Background:

    • Pancreatic pseudocysts are a common complication of pancreatitis.
    • Accurate diagnosis and assessment of pseudocyst extent are crucial for patient management.
    • Both sonography and computed tomography (CT) are used for evaluation.

    Purpose of the Study:

    • To compare the diagnostic accuracy of sonography and CT in evaluating suspected pancreatic pseudocysts.
    • To determine which imaging modality better demonstrates the extent of pancreatic pseudocysts.

    Main Methods:

    • Retrospective review of 54 patients referred for suspected pancreatic pseudocyst.
    • All patients underwent both sonographic and abdominal CT examinations.
    • Comparison of imaging findings with proven pseudocyst diagnoses.

    Main Results:

    • CT correctly identified 23 of 24 pseudocysts, with one false-negative and two false-positive results.
    • Sonography had technically inadequate studies in 20 of 54 patients.
    • Sonography diagnosed 18 of 24 pseudocysts, but findings were less complete than CT in 10 cases; there was one false-negative and three false-positive sonographic studies.

    Conclusions:

    • Computed tomography (CT) demonstrates superior accuracy compared to sonography for diagnosing pancreatic pseudocysts.
    • CT is more effective than sonography in delineating the full extent of pancreatic pseudocysts.
    • CT is the preferred imaging modality for evaluating suspected pancreatic pseudocysts.
